Released in 2001, Fulltime Killer is an action, thriller, drama and crime film directed by Johnnie To, running about 102 minutes. “A story of two killers with different ideals...” — that tagline sets the tone.

What it’s about. Professional assassin O has resided in an isolated world of killing and loneliness. But his life begins to change once he meets the innocent Chin; hired to clean O's apartment. However, soon the flamboyent and reckless Tok enters Chin's life with a mission to unveil O's identity and usurp his place as the number one sharp-shooting assassin in the game.

Who’s in it. Fulltime Killer stars Andy Lau as Lok Tok-Wah, Takashi Sorimachi as O, Simon Yam as Albert Lee and Kelly Lin as Chin, among others.
